// Loyalty ledger client for Pointsmith.
// All writes are append-only; corrections go through reversal entries,
// never deletes. Batch flushes every 500ms or 200 entries, whichever
// comes first. Retries are idempotent via the entry UUID.
// The client authenticates against the internal Ledgerline service,
// which validates merchant scope per request.
// The service key used for initialization follows below.

app token of kagap-fahag = zpat2_0m

Subject: Fabrikoid on-call basics

Fabrikoid is our test-data factory library. Releases of dependent services can break if factory schemas drift from production schemas. Before cutting a release, run the drift check; red means hold. Pages about seed-data failures almost always trace back to an unversioned factory change. Do not hotfix factories in place. The drift dashboard and rollback steps are on the internal page below.

runbook for badug-kadup: https://confluence.zemvarlabs.internal/projects/browse/display/projects/bd1b

## Cutting over from Queuewright

We're finally retiring the homegrown Queuewright job queue in favor of Relaypond. The migration script moves pending jobs in batches, so expect a short window where both systems report counts — that's normal. Don't flip the producer flag until the consumer pods on Relaypond show green for five straight minutes. Rollback is just re-enabling the old dispatcher; nothing is deleted. Before you start, confirm the new broker is running with the settings below.

deployment values, yahag-tawef:
ZORWYN_HOST=zorwyn.tolvaqlabs.internal
ZORWYN_PORT=9300